To view your microSD card storage information:

1.

Press

>

and tap

>

SD card & phone storage.

2.

Locate the

External SD card

section.

3.

Review both the

Total space

and

Available space

fields:

Total space

indicates the total size of the currently

inserted microSD card. This includes both
available and used space information.

To determine the currently amount of used
memory on the card, take the Total space and
subtract the remaining available space.

Available space

indicates only the amount of

remaining free memory space available on the
microSD card.

Manage Running Services

This service is an efficient method for managing power
consumption and processor/memory resources.
Processes can be stopped until the device is restarted.

To stop a currently running service:

1.

Press

>

and tap

> Applications

> Running services.

2.

Tap an onscreen process entry.

3.

Read the

Stop service?

dialog and touch

Stop

.

Note:

Not all of the microSD card is registered in the available
space as a small percentage of the storage is unread.
A 2GB microSD card will show approximately 1.89GB
available.
